Subject: Template rendering perf fix shipped

Team — the Fennwick rendering patch is now in staging. Cold-start render times for the Oakhollow invoice templates dropped from roughly 900ms to 140ms after we moved partial compilation ahead of the request path. New contractors: please run the render benchmark suite before signing off, and flag any template exceeding 200ms. Rollout to production is scheduled for Thursday. The staging environment is running the build noted just below.

pipeline stamp: htk6_35e0c9

- [ ] Stale-cache postmortem sign-off (Pebbleworks incident #theta)

Before we cut the new signing keys, double-check the postmortem for the stale-cache bug in Cacheloaf is actually merged — the fix that invalidates entries on schema bumps, not just TTL expiry. Reviewers: confirm the regression test covers the double-write race. Once that's green, the ceremony lead unseals the escrow envelope; the recovery passphrase for it follows.

vault phrase of tawig-taduf = zorath-oliwyn

## Changelog — Crashbeacon pipeline, 2024-11 rotation

We finally rotated the upload-signing key for the Crashbeacon mobile crash-report pipeline (the old one dated back to the Pellworth prototype days, yikes). Reports signed with the old key are rejected as of this release; clients on v3.2+ picked up the new key automatically. Verification logs are in the pipeline dashboard if you want to audit the cutover. The new signing key, for your review, follows.

deploy key for kahof-tadup: bky4_rRMZ